Why do people misjudge national minorities? Psychologist explains

Summary by fakt.pl
People are often wrong. They overestimate small social groups and underestimate large ones. However, this is not because they feel threatened by them, as previously assumed. Apparently, it's about something else. “We rely on our expectations and biases, regardless of their assessment,” explains Andreas Zick, director of the Institute for Interdisciplinary Research on Conflict and Violence.
